Korzystanie z Entity FrameWork z wieloma bazami danych MS SQLSERVER

Szukałem tam iz powrotem, ale pozornie nie mogłem zdobyć tego, czego potrzebuję. Przykro mi, jeśli na to ostatnio padło. Przekierowanie do dyskusji dobrze mi zrobi.

To jest scenariusz. Polecono mi przejść od Microsoft Visual Foxpro (MS wycofuje wsparcie przyjść 2015) do .Net C # przez mojego szefa. W trosce o dobre podstawy i przyjęcie najlepszych praktyk, zdecydowałem się najpierw poznać, połączyć istotne informacje, a następnie rozpocząć kodowanie. To już drugi rok.

Jesteśmy firmą biurową, która oferuje usługi outsourcingu obsługi płac dla ponad 50 klientów. Każdy klient ma obecnie własną bazę danych. Bazy danych mają tabele o całkowicie identycznych strukturach.

Jestem nowicjuszem. Całkowicie nowy w świecie .net.

Zacząłem od surowego SQL używając danych, danych, ale w moich badaniach miałem pewne dyskusje zniechęcające to. Wielu było zdania, że ​​ramy podmiotu powinny służyć temu celowi. Można jednak łączyć różne podejścia, zwłaszcza w przypadku złożonych zapytań.

Czy ktoś może wskazać mi „dobrą lekturę”, w której mogę zaimplementować Entity Framework z ponad 50 indentycznymi bazami danych. Każda baza danych jest całkowicie niezależna i nie ma nic do powiedzenia. Gdy użytkownik się loguje, wybiera klienta, dla którego ma przetwarzać listy płac, a następnie EF wskazuje tę bazę danych.

questionAnswers(3)

yourAnswerToTheQuestion